Oslo transit agency orders 183 Solaris Urbino 18 electric buses
As US cities experiment with electric bus pilots, one transit agency in Norway is already replacing its existing e-buses with next-generation models. Oslo transit agency Unibuss has ordered 183 Solaris Urbino 18 electric buses in a deal worth approximately €100 million ($115 million). Solaris’s new Urbino 9 LE electric bus
Polish bus builder Solaris has unveiled its latest vehicle, the 9-metre low-entry Urbino 9 LE electric. It’s designed both for city and intercity routes, and Solaris calls it “an excellent link between the urban and suburban road network across conurbations.” The new e-bus has been standardized with all Solaris’s other 4th-generation vehicles. Romania to deploy 123 Solaris electric buses
Polish bus builder Solaris has further expanded its penetration of Europe’s public transport market with a hefty order for 123 electric buses in Romania. The total value of the contract is estimated at nearly €65 million. Seven Romanian municipalities have joined in a tender for 131 zero-emission e-buses. Berlin adds 90 Solaris e-buses, expanding its electric fleet to 123 units
Polish bus builder Solaris has delivered 90 new Urbino 12 electric buses to Berlin’s BVG transit agency, bringing the number of Solaris electric buses operating in Berlin to a total of 123. Electric buses in Europe: 50 Solaris Urbinos for Poland, 22 Volvo buses for Norway
The Polish city of Cracow has ordered 50 Solaris Urbino 18 electric buses, along with 50 plug-in charging stations. The city’s transit agency, MPK, already operates 400 Solaris buses, including 28 electric buses. The new vehicles will be delivered within a year. The order is worth approximately 36 million euros. Solaris to develop new 15-meter electric bus
Solaris is developing a new 15-meter electric bus. Called the Urbino 15 LE electric, the tri-axle bus will be built with Scandinavian markets in mind. Konin, Poland orders six Solaris electric buses
The municipal transit operator Miejski Zakład Komunikacyjnycity (MZK) in Konin, Poland has ordered six Solaris Urbino 12 electric buses and three chargers, which are scheduled for delivery by the end of May 2020. 30 Solaris electric buses coming to the islands of Venice
Venice, Italy’s transit operator, ACTV SPA Venezia, has ordered 30 Solaris Urbino 12 electric buses, nine fast pantograph chargers, six fixed plug-in chargers, and a mobile plug-in charger. Milan to purchase up to 250 Solaris electric buses
ATM Milano, the transit operator of Milan, Italy, has announced that it will phase out diesel buses by 2030 and use €194 million (around $216 million) to purchase up to 250 electric buses, beginning with 40 from Solaris.
